As I Began to Dream is a narrative-driven puzzle platformer on Nintendo Switch that focuses less on action and more on emotional storytelling. Centred on themes of loss, healing, and self-reflection, the game invites players into a quiet dream world where puzzles and atmosphere work together to explore grief in a thoughtful, accessible way.
An Emotional Story Told in Stages
The game follows Lily, a young girl navigating a surreal dreamscape alongside her turtle companion. Each chapter is inspired by one of the five stages of grief—denial, anger, bargaining, depression, and acceptance—and each carries its own visual tone and emotional weight. Rather than relying on heavy dialogue, the narrative unfolds through environments, subtle interactions, and mood, allowing players to interpret Lily’s journey at their own pace.
While the story is simple on the surface, it carries emotional depth that slowly reveals itself as Lily progresses. The gradual shift in atmosphere between chapters helps reinforce her healing process and gives the experience a sense of purpose beyond simply reaching the next level.
Puzzle-Focused Gameplay With a Relaxed Pace
Gameplay revolves around 2D puzzle-platforming where players manipulate the environment to clear paths, avoid hazards, and overcome enemies indirectly. Lily can swap, rotate, and move parts of the world from specific points, turning each area into a spatial puzzle rather than a combat challenge.
The difficulty increases gradually, offering a smooth learning curve that makes the game approachable for a wide range of players. However, puzzle solutions can be quite rigid, and the limited interactivity may feel restrictive for those seeking more freedom or action. Progression depends entirely on solving puzzles correctly, which can occasionally feel frustrating when physics or timing do not behave as expected.
Storybook Visuals and a Soothing Soundscape
Visually, As I Began to Dream leans into a hand-drawn, storybook aesthetic. Soft colors and simple designs create a dreamlike quality that shifts with each stage of grief, keeping environments visually distinct while maintaining a cohesive style.
The soundtrack complements this approach with calm, melancholic melodies that reinforce the introspective tone. Music and visuals work together to create a peaceful, almost meditative experience, encouraging players to slow down and absorb the atmosphere.
A Quiet Experience With a Clear Audience
As I Began to Dream is a short, emotionally driven experience best suited for players who enjoy narrative-focused games and gentle puzzle-solving. It is family-friendly and accessible, but its slow pace and minimal action may test the patience of those looking for constant engagement or mechanical depth.
For players willing to meet it on its own terms, the game offers a bittersweet and memorable journey. Its exploration of grief through simple mechanics and thoughtful presentation makes it less about challenge and more about reflection, leaving a lasting impression through mood and meaning rather than spectacle.
